A weekly series that focuses on relevant and timely topics in primary care medicine, offering insights and guidance for healthcare professionals. It covers a wide range of issues from the latest treatment guidelines to discussions around chronic diseases, mental health, and preventive care strategies, making it a valuable resource for clinicians looking to stay informed. Unique to this series are its practical applications of evidence-based medicine, with cases discussed that are directly applicable to everyday clinical practice. Episodes often include current research and provide an accessible format for ongoing education in the field.
